Global supply chains are increasingly sensitive to lead times and precision tolerances. Many overseas construction and manufacturing facilities struggle to find factories that can handle both delicate, high-finish surface door frame components and massive structural landing decks.
Our manufacturing base in Foshan City utilizes Fenglu billets to control alloy impurities, providing consistent mechanical properties (tensile strength, yield strength, and elongation). This is critical for projects across Europe, North America, and the Middle East, where local construction codes require verification of material certificates (such as Mill Test Certificates to EN 10204 3.1) prior to installation.
